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Use macos-13 to buid MacOS x86_64 PHP #203

Merged
merged 3 commits into from
Dec 19, 2024
Merged

Use macos-13 to buid MacOS x86_64 PHP #203

merged 3 commits into from
Dec 19, 2024

Conversation

Sunch233
Copy link
Contributor

The macOS-12 environment is deprecated.
see actions/runner-images#10721

The macOS-12 environment is deprecated. 
(see actions/runner-images#10721 )
@dktapps
Copy link
Member

dktapps commented Dec 10, 2024

I thought the macos-14 image was exclusively arm64. That job is for x86_64.

@Sunch233
Copy link
Contributor Author

I thought the macos-14 image was exclusively arm64. That job is for x86_64.

It looks like we're only going to have to use macOS-13 anymore. Because macos-14-large is billed.

@Sunch233 Sunch233 changed the title Use macos-14 to buid MacOS x86_64 PHP Use macos-13 to buid MacOS x86_64 PHP Dec 10, 2024
@dktapps
Copy link
Member

dktapps commented Dec 10, 2024

I guess we'll have to drop support for Intel Macs sometime in the not too distant future then.

Technically I think the arm64 runner can build them, but the problem is that there's no way to verify that the binary works on an actual x86_64 chip (as in, not Rosetta). So the quality of support for Intel Macs will only go downhill if we lose access to x86_64 runners.

@dktapps dktapps merged commit 8cb0722 into pmmp:stable Dec 19, 2024
11 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ants